Abstract

The invention relates to a preparation method of modern Longquan Ge kiln porcelain, which adopts mineral raw materials and chemical raw materials and comprises the following steps: Step 1: adding a certain amount of alumina powder and balled iron paste pug into kaoline pug, and obtaining a green body by slurrying, forming and drying; Step 2: spraying balled iron paste slurry onto the internal and external surfaces of the dry green body prepared in the previous step, and obtaining a bisque body via drying and bisque firing; Step 3: applying a first layer of Ge kiln glaze on the internal and external surfaces of the bisque body prepared in the previous step in a rinsing manner, and applying a second layer of Ge kiln glaze on the surface of the first layer of Ge kiln glaze in a glaze spraying manner after the glaze is aired till the water content is less than 30%; and Step 4: after drying the bisque body, putting into a kiln for high-temperature firing by a reduction flame to form a modern Longquan Ge kiln porcelain product. The product has rich colors, clear crack grain, a strong stereoscopic contrast feeling, an excellent artistic effect and wide application prospects.

Background technology
The iron tire purple mouth iron foot government porcelain kiln goods of dragon's fountain brother kiln, be found in the Southern Song Dynasty apart from modern about 1000, condense the porcelain making elite place of dragon's fountain artisan, but owing to there are following technological difficulties in its preparation process, first: be fired into power low, due in the iron tire foot purple mouth goods china clay used that tradition fires brother's kiln containing higher ferro element, the desired firing temperature of Longqun Cave pyrogene porcelain is not reached when firing, easily cause base substrate to subside, deformation rate is large, the problem of easily hardening cracking; Second: the problem of base glaze coefficient of expansion coupling, base substrate and mineral glaze is caused to be difficult to combine with it because the shrinking percentage of the purple mouth goods of conventional iron tire foot is excessive with instability, in the process of kiln cooling, the shrinkage rates of base substrate is greater than the shrinkage rates of glaze paint, and the crackle that glaze paint will be caused to occur that opening is larger can hurt user instead of the distinctive little open-delta winding of dragon's fountain; 3rd: the problem of color development instability, the conventional iron tire purple mouth goods of foot because its raw material adopts is the distinctive natural high Fe contained china clay in dragon's fountain native country because iron-holder main in china clay is unstable, so the instability of its color development can be caused; 4th: goods hold yielding problem, because the iron-holder of the purple mouth goods of conventional iron tire foot is higher, cause base substrate fusing point to reduce, during high-temperature firing, the shrinking percentage of china clay is comparatively large, can cause subsiding of carcass after cooling.Due to above technological difficulties, cause the making handicraft of the purple mouth goods of iron tire foot in the succession process in later stage because the difficulty of difficult forming complex process handicraft succession greatly, causes the handicraft of the purple mouth iron foot of iron tire to run off in a large number.
Summary of the invention
The technical problem to be solved in the present invention is to provide a kind of bottleneck breaking through the purple mouth product producing process of traditional dragon's fountain brother kiln iron tire foot, utilizes natural mineral and industrial chemicals to prepare the preparation method of modern dragon's fountain brother kiln porcelain.
For solving above technical problem, technical scheme of the present invention is: a kind of preparation method of modern dragon's fountain brother kiln porcelain, adopts raw mineral materials and industrial chemicals, comprises the following steps:
Step one: add a certain amount of alumina powder and baslled iron mud pug in kaolin pug, obtains base substrate after changing slurry, shaping, drying;
Step 2: spray baslled iron material-mud on the dry base substrate surfaces externally and internally that upper step is obtained, then carries out drying, biscuiting obtains plain tire;
Step 3: the surfaces externally and internally obtaining plain tire in upper step adopt swing glaze mode on the first layer Geware glaze, wait dry to glaze water ratio lower than 30% after, then adopt the mode of glaze spraying second layer Geware glaze on the surface of the first layer Geware glaze;
Step 4: previous step glaze tire enters kiln through reducing flame high-temperature firing, obtains modern dragon's fountain brother kiln porcelain products after drying.
The material composition of described baslled iron mud pug is by weight percentage: Zijin soil 65%, fireclay 16%, kaolin 19%.
The preparation technology of described baslled iron material-mud is: in baslled iron mud pug, add its weight percent content is after the kaolin pug of 0 ~ 50%, through changing slurry, sieving and obtaining the baslled iron material-mud that water ratio is 25 ~ 50%.
After described baslled iron material-mud sieves, fineness is be less than 1% more than 10000-hole sieve.
The material composition of described Geware glaze is by weight percentage: kaolin 66.25%, plant ash 26.25%, Wingdale 3.75%, fluorite 2.5%, feldspar 1.25%.
In described step one, the add-on of alumina powder is 0.75 ~ 1.75% of kaolin pug quality, and the add-on of baslled iron mud pug is for kaolin pug quality 0 ~ 80%, and drying temperature is 100 DEG C.
In described step 2, baslled iron material-mud is sprayed on the thickness of base substrate surfaces externally and internally is 1 ~ 2mm.
In described step 2, bake out temperature is 100 DEG C, and biscuiting temperature is 800 ~ 860 DEG C.
In described step 3, the thickness of the first layer Geware glaze is 1 ~ 2mm, and the thickness of second layer Geware glaze is 1 ~ 2mm.
In described step 4, bake out temperature is 100 DEG C, and the temperature of high-temperature firing is 1240 ~ 1320 DEG C.
The preparation method of modern dragon's fountain brother kiln porcelain involved in the present invention, the natural mineral raw all adopting dragon's fountain locality to produce and industrial waste, the adaptation of product is wide, has objectively reproduced the unique products feature of dragon's fountain brother kiln in ancient times.Simultaneously, the present invention is by changing the add-on of aluminum oxide and baslled iron mud in blank, reach the object of adjustment base glaze matched expansion coefficient, the cracking degree of glaze paint can be controlled arbitrarily according to customer need, simultaneously by changing kaolinic add-on in baslled iron material-mud, reach the object controlling base substrate color, the product quality fired reaches the level of the purple mouth goods of traditional dragon's fountain brother kiln iron tire foot, method therefor of the present invention is scientific and reasonable, easy to implement, easy and simple to handle, good stability, conforming product rate are high, therefore has fabulous economy and social value.
Embodiment
Embodiment 1
Step one: add 1g alumina powder and 30g baslled iron mud pug in 100g kaolin pug, obtains base substrate after changing slurry, shaping, the 100 DEG C of dryings of throwing;
Step 2: spray the baslled iron material-mud that the thick water ratio of 1mm is 30% on the dry base substrate surfaces externally and internally that upper step obtains, then carries out 100 DEG C of oven dry, 810 DEG C of biscuitings obtains plain tire;
Step 3: the surfaces externally and internally obtaining plain tire in upper step adopt swing glaze mode on the thick the first layer Geware glaze of 1mm, wait dry to glaze water ratio lower than 30% after, then adopt the second layer Geware glaze of the mode of glaze spraying 2mm on the surface of the first layer Geware glaze;
Step 4: after 100 DEG C, previous step glaze tire is dried, enters kiln through reducing flame in 1260 DEG C of high-temperature firings, obtains modern dragon's fountain brother kiln porcelain products.
The material composition of described baslled iron mud pug is by weight percentage: Zijin soil 65%, fireclay 16%, kaolin 19%.
The material composition of described Geware glaze is by weight percentage: kaolin 66.25%, plant ash 26.25%, Wingdale 3.75%, fluorite 2.5%, feldspar 1.25%.
The preparation technology of described baslled iron material-mud is: in baslled iron mud pug, add its weight percent content is after the kaolin pug of 10%, through changing slurry, crossing ten thousand mesh sieves, tailing over and be less than 1%, obtains the baslled iron material-mud that water ratio is 30%.
The present embodiment resulting product is iron tire vola, purple tire mouth, and carcass becomes light green, and glaze paint is fine cracks lines, three-dimensional contrast feels strong, and artistic effect is splendid.
Embodiment 2
Step one: add 1.5g alumina powder and 70g baslled iron mud pug in 100g kaolin pug, obtains base substrate after changing slurry, shaping, the 100 DEG C of dryings of throwing;
Step 2: spray the baslled iron material-mud that the thick water ratio of 2mm is 40% on the dry base substrate surfaces externally and internally that upper step obtains, then carries out 100 DEG C of oven dry, 830 DEG C of biscuitings obtains plain tire;
Step 3: the surfaces externally and internally obtaining plain tire in upper step adopt swing glaze mode on the thick the first layer Geware glaze of 2mm, wait dry to glaze water ratio lower than 30% after, then adopt the second layer Geware glaze of the mode of glaze spraying 2mm on the surface of the first layer Geware glaze;
Step 4: after 100 DEG C, previous step glaze tire is dried, enters kiln through reducing flame in 1300 DEG C of high-temperature firings, obtains modern dragon's fountain brother kiln porcelain products.
The material composition of described baslled iron mud pug is by weight percentage: Zijin soil 65%, fireclay 16%, kaolin 19%.
The material composition of described Geware glaze is by weight percentage: kaolin 66.25%, plant ash 26.25%, Wingdale 3.75%, fluorite 2.5%, feldspar 1.25%.
The preparation technology of described baslled iron material-mud is: in baslled iron mud pug, add its weight percent content is after the kaolin pug of 25%, through changing slurry, crossing ten thousand mesh sieves, tailing over and be less than 1%, obtains the baslled iron material-mud that water ratio is 40%.
The present embodiment resulting product is iron tire vola, purple tire mouth, and carcass becomes blackish green, and glaze paint is thick crackle lines, three-dimensional contrast feels strong, and artistic effect is splendid.
Embodiment 3
Step one: add 1.7g alumina powder in 100g kaolin pug, obtains base substrate after changing slurry, shaping, the 100 DEG C of dryings of throwing;
Step 2: spray the baslled iron material-mud that the thick water ratio of 2mm is 50% on the dry base substrate surfaces externally and internally that upper step obtains, then carries out 100 DEG C of oven dry, 850 DEG C of biscuitings obtains plain tire;
Step 3: the surfaces externally and internally obtaining plain tire in upper step adopt swing glaze mode on the thick the first layer Geware glaze of 2mm, wait dry to glaze water ratio lower than 30% after, then adopt the second layer Geware glaze of the mode of glaze spraying 2mm on the surface of the first layer Geware glaze;
Step 4: after 100 DEG C, previous step glaze tire is dried, enters kiln through reducing flame in 1320 DEG C of high-temperature firings, obtains modern dragon's fountain brother kiln porcelain products.
The material composition of described baslled iron mud pug is by weight percentage: Zijin soil 65%, fireclay 16%, kaolin 19%.
The material composition of described Geware glaze is by weight percentage: kaolin 66.25%, plant ash 26.25%, Wingdale 3.75%, fluorite 2.5%, feldspar 1.25%.
The preparation technology of described baslled iron material-mud is: in baslled iron mud pug, add its weight percent content is after the kaolin pug of 45%, through changing slurry, crossing ten thousand mesh sieves, tailing over and be less than 1%, obtains the baslled iron material-mud that water ratio is 50%.
The present embodiment resulting product is iron tire vola, purple tire mouth, and carcass becomes deep green, and strongly, artistic effect is splendid for glaze paint flawless lines, three-dimensional contrast sense.
